git默认几个分支
-
Git 默认有两个分支,一个是 `master` 分支,另一个是 `develop` 分支。
`master` 分支是Git的默认分支,它是用于存储稳定版本的代码。开发人员通常会在 `master` 分支上进行发布和部署。当一个功能或修复任务完成且经过测试后,会将代码合并到 `master` 分支上。
`develop` 分支是进行日常开发的主要分支,它是用于合并各个开发人员的功能分支和修复分支的地方。开发人员在自己的分支上完成各自的开发工作后,会将代码合并到 `develop` 分支上进行集成测试。
除了这两个默认分支外,开发团队还可以根据需要创建其他分支,比如 `feature` 分支用于开发具体的功能模块,`bugfix` 分支用于修复代码中的bug等。
总结起来,Git 默认有两个分支 `master` 和 `develop`,开发团队可以根据需要创建其他分支来进行具体的开发和修复工作。
2年前 -
Git默认有两个分支,即主分支(master)和开发分支(develop)。
1. 主分支(master):主分支是项目的稳定版本。它通常用于存放已经发布的代码,也就是经过测试和验证的可靠版本。在Git初始化一个仓库时,会自动生成主分支。
2. 开发分支(develop):开发分支是项目的主要开发分支。所有的新功能、Bug修复和其他开发工作都在开发分支上进行。在创建一个新的Git仓库后,一般会从主分支(master)切换到开发分支(develop)。
除了以上两个默认分支,还有一些常用的附加分支:
3. 功能分支(feature branches):功能分支用于开发新的功能或添加新的特性。每个功能分支都是从开发分支(develop)分离出来的,开发者可以在功能分支上进行独立的开发工作。一旦开发工作完成,功能分支通常会合并回开发分支。
4. Bug修复分支(bugfix branches):Bug修复分支用于处理紧急Bug修复。当出现Bug时,可以从主分支(master)或开发分支(develop)分离出一个bug修复分支,修复完毕后再合并回原来的分支。
5. 发布分支(release branches):发布分支用于准备发布新的版本。一般在即将发布新版本之前,从开发分支(develop)派生出一个发布分支,这样其他开发人员可以继续在开发分支上进行新功能的开发。在发布分支上进行最后的测试和版本准备工作,完成后再合并回主分支(master)和开发分支(develop)。
需要注意的是,Git的分支是非常灵活的,可以根据项目的具体需求创建自定义分支。以上只是一种常见的分支管理策略,可以根据团队的开发工作流程和需求进行调整。
2年前 -
Git 默认有两个分支:主分支(master)和开发分支(develop)。
1. 主分支(master)是默认的主要分支,也是生产环境上的稳定分支。通常情况下,只有通过充分测试和审核的代码才能合并到主分支中。在创建新的仓库时,主分支是自动创建的,并且是默认的活动分支。
2. 开发分支(develop)是用于开发新功能和组织开发工作的分支。当从主分支派生出新的开发分支时,通常会基于主分支创建一个新的开发分支,并在此分支上进行新功能的开发。开发分支上可能会有多个开发者同时开展工作,所以经常需要进行分支合并来整合各个开发者的工作。
除了这两个默认分支外,还可以通过创建其他分支来完成不同的开发任务或处理不同的问题。在开发过程中,可以根据需要创建新的分支,以便并行开展多个任务,每个分支都有自己的开发进度和修改历史。等到任务完成后,可以将分支合并到主分支或开发分支中。
总结:除了主分支(master)和开发分支(develop)之外,Git 默认没有其他特定的分支,分支的创建和使用根据具体的项目需求和开发流程来决定。
2年前